Second Front Systems is a rapidly growing company operating at the intersection of national security and innovative technology. We are looking for a senior Product Marketing Manager to join our team and help shape the narrative for our mission-critical software solutions. As a public benefit corporation founded by former U.S. Marines, we focus on accelerating government access to commercially proven technologies, and this role is essential for bridging the gap between our technical offerings and the real-world needs of our national security partners. Please note that U.S. citizenship is required for this position due to the nature of our government contracts.
